5 easy ways to store garlic for long time/다섯가지 마늘 보관법:

5 LBs peeled garlic cloves
1 medium onion
Some vegetable oil
Steps:
1. Rinse and dry garlic cloves
2. Remove dried brown garlic roots
First way: Slice 1-2 cups of garlic and store in a jar with vegetable oil; make sure to submerge garlic slices in the oil. Store in the refrigerator.
2nd way: Crush garlic and onion, then store in a jar with vegetable oil; make sure to submerge crushed garlic in the oil. Store in the refrigerator.
3rd way: Store Crushed garlic in a jar without adding any oil. Store in the refrigerator.
4th way: Freeze crushed garlic in a plastic bag.
5th way: Freeze whole garlic cloves in a plastic bag.
